The timing/sequencing issues with the SNAP cost shift are only one of the worst aspects of the policy design. The second worst aspect is the incentive to drop eligible participants. The first worst aspect is that whole states are going to drop out of the program entirely.

Katie Bergh

This is key: Chair Boozman says this gives "additional time to strengthen administration of SNAP benefits and reduce payment error rates." It does not. The cost shift would still be based on error rates for this fiscal year — so the window to make progress has largely closed.

🚨NEW: In the 9 months after last year’s reconciliation law enacted unprecedented SNAP cuts, the number of people receiving SNAP fell by more than 4.5 million. Based on available data, we estimate that at least 1.5 million fewer kids are receiving SNAP. www.cbpp.org/research/foo...

SNAP Tracker: People Are Losing Food Assistance as the Republican Megabill Is ImplementedSNAP participation nationwide fell by more than 4 million people (nearly 10 percent) between the law’s July 2025 enactment and March 2026, based on the latest month of data.www.cbpp.org
